EPL: West London Derby Sees Fulham Snatch 3-2 Comeback Victory Against Brentford
EPL

In a chill West London derby at the Gtech Community Stadium today, Fulham did a spirited comeback to defeat Brentford 3-2.

The match began with Raul Jimenez heading Fulham into an early lead in the 16th minute, yet Brentford responded swiftly. Bryan Mbeumo leveled the score just six minutes later, and Yoane Wissa added another for the Bees shortly before halftime, giving them a 2-1 advantage.

However, the second half saw a determined Fulham side emerge. Tom Cairney equalized with a header in the 68th minute, and just two minutes later, Harry Wilson unleashed a curling shot from outside the box to secure a dramatic win for the Cottagers.

Brentford, despite a strong first-half showing with goals from Mbeumo and Wissa, couldn’t maintain their lead. The match was filled with attacking intent from both sides, featuring a saved penalty from Mbeumo in the first half, adding to the drama.

Ultimately, Fulham’s second-half surge, spearheaded by Cairney and Wilson, proved decisive, earning them a valuable three points and keeping their hopes for a higher league finish alive.
